Frank Christensen+FollowEstrogen’s Secret Power Over Hormones?Turns out, estrogen doesn’t just boss around the brain (hypothalamus)—it also tells the pituitary gland to chill on hormone release, especially FSH. But here’s the twist: as women age, the pituitary gets less sensitive to estrogen’s feedback, mainly for FSH, not so much for LH. Frank Christensen+FollowEarly Menopause & Brain Health Link?Did you know going through menopause before 40 could mean a higher risk of brain decline later on? A new study found women with early menopause had more memory and thinking issues than those who started after 50. Even after accounting for depression, the link stuck around. Hormone therapy didn’t seem to help either. Michelle Chen+FollowCannabis & Dementia: Surprising Study LinkJust read a wild study—turns out people who end up in the ER or hospital because of cannabis are at a much higher risk of developing dementia later on. We’re talking a 23% higher risk compared to others in the hospital, and a whopping 72% more than the general population! It doesn’t mean weed directly causes dementia, but with more older adults using it, this is definitely something to keep an eye on.
